Thumbs up Wheels ROCK AND ROLL!!!!

When I first got into Stamping, I bought the wheels first....could get more for my small buck! hee hee

One tip that someone told me was to go diagnolly starting from the bottom left hand corner, that way you can see where to line it up. That made it MUCH easier for me. I still wanna get the Wheel Guide so I can practice my straight wheeling!

Quote:

Originally Posted by my4blessings
Can I ask you a question about this, Emily? I am also planning to buy the Jumbo Mixed Bouquet wheel in my order next week and either want to have ink in white or versa. Did you buy the Jumbo One Cell cartridge and then the Whisper White refill? I feel like this should be an easy question but I'm having trouble figuring this out from the catty. Thanks!
yes, they sell a regular cartridge in white and a white refill. To do jumbo you have to buy an empty jumbo cartridge and the white refill. White reinker won't work cause it's a thicker consistency.
